Holding Food Delivery App Drivers Accountable for Losses

If a DoorDash driver causes an accident to you while you are in another vehicle, does DoorDash pay your medical bills? It can be frustrating to learn that some organizations rate and reward drivers for being fast, and that could lead to a higher risk of reckless driving.

When a driver causes an accident, there are typically two potential outcomes:

  • The driver was engaged with the app and provided services directly to the company. The food delivery app service could be held accountable for the driver’s accident in this situation. Moreover, since these organizations tend to have more significant liability insurance policies, you may be able to recover more of your losses.
  • The driver was not providing an actual service at the time of the accident. In this situation, the driver is responsible for any damages they cause, but it is also critical to know that the delivery service may not be responsible.

Why Food Delivery App Car Accidents Happen in Buffalo

These types of car accidents happen for reasons such as:

  • The driver was distracted by using the app instead of focusing on the roadways
  • The driver was operating the vehicle recklessly, such as by speeding, running red lights, or following others too closely.
  • Fatigue or impairment played a role in the driver’s inability to operate the vehicle in a safe manner.

These are just some of the most common causes of such accidents. Keep in mind that the type of accident can matter. For example, if the car breaks down because it was not maintained by the driver, the delivery app company may not be responsible.
